Transportation in the U.S.: Perspectives on Federal Policies : Aircraft Manufacturing: Changing Conditions and Federal Policies.
Examines the increased competition from foreign producers and other changes affecting the U.S. commercial aircraft manufacturing industry. Looks at possible changes in the industry's relationship to the Federal Government.
